In 2012, the “Fly Away” singer was photographed by paparazzi wearing the mega-sized accessory while running errands in New York City. The snapshots have since been used in countless hilarious memes more than a decade later.in 2018. “I cannot escape this,” the always fashionable singer said. “I live in the Bahamas. I’m used to hot weather and I had to go to the grocery store. I was buying some groceries and I thought I’d put on a little scarf to protect my throat and that’s the scarf I had.
